A miniaturized ultra-wideband (UWB) antenna has been designed. It is used for the WLAN with notched band. A circle slot is etched on the radiation patch; a cross strip line is added in the middle of patch. This structure makes antenna with the effect of notch, which can effectively restrain narrowband spectrum interference with WLAN. Using the electromagnetic simulation software, the miniaturized size of antenna structure is carried out. Fabricated sample verifies that the antenna can be suitable for the requirement of notched UWB application.
